Senior Accountant

Position Housed At Desert Diamond West Valley Property (9431 W Northern Ave, Glendale, Az 85305)

Position Summary

Under general supervision of the Finance Supervisor, the position monitors the business activities of the organization through the maintenance and audit of records related to financial reporting.  This will include monitoring and reconciling balance sheets and income statement activity, while working with the accounting team members and other departments to ensure accurate and timely information is being generated by the Finance Department.  The position must have excellent analytical skills and in-depth knowledge of accounting principles to efficiently create and analyze financial records.  The position maintains confidentiality of all privileged information.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

Maintains general and subsidiary ledgers, updates cash flow worksheets; prepares bank/wire transfers; reconciles balance sheet accounts; contributes in the preparation of regular and special fiscal statements and reports.Manages leases, calculations and reporting.Responsible for all matters pertaining to the operation and maintenance of the Fixed Asset System.Prepares and reviews, revenue, expense, payroll, and related journal entries.  Monitors revenue and expenses; ensures expenditure control and compliance with funding and reporting requirements, and standard accounting procedures.  Prepares working papers for audit.Assists with and contributes to internal and external audit request.Assists with and contributes to risk assessment evaluations as they occur.Assists department directors and managers in providing financial and statistical reporting requests.Ensures compliance with approved Minimum Internal Control Standards (MICS), State, and National Gaming Regulations.Contributes to the review and development of Internal Controls and Policies and Procedures.Manages requestor training for account coding.Supports Fixed Asset System in construction, maintenance capital and annual inventory.Reviews and reconciles all IRS tax reporting requirements. Manages credit card processing and fraud monitoring of all bank accounts.Assists with construction and special projects.Ensures strict confidentiality of financial records.Performs other duties as assigned.
